A global insurance firm seeks a Compliance Officer to ensure compliance oversight for its international operations. This role includes guiding business divisions on regulatory matters and providing compliance advice to support business goals.
The ideal candidate will have relevant experience in the insurance industry, strong communication skills, and be prepared to pursue ongoing professional development.
This position offers a competitive salary, an annual bonus, and various employee benefits, including a strong pension scheme and opportunities for career growth.

How to prepare for a job interview at Markel
✨Know Your Regulations
Make sure you brush up on the key regulations that affect the insurance industry. Familiarise yourself with the latest compliance standards and how they apply to international operations. This will show your potential employer that you're not just knowledgeable but also proactive about staying updated.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
As a Compliance Officer, you'll need to communicate complex regulatory matters clearly.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ully conveyed compliance advice to different business divisions. This will demonstrate your ability to bridge the gap between compliance and business goals.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ills in compliance situations. Think of specific instances where you had to navigate regulatory challenges and how you approached them. This will help you illustrate your practical experience and decision-making process.
✨Highlight Your Commitment to Development
The job description mentions ongoing professional development, so be ready to discuss any relevant certifications or training you've pursued. Talk about how you plan to continue growing in your role and staying ahead in the compliance field. This shows your dedication to both personal and professional growth.
